Vine pruning is a crucial practice for preserving healthy development, managing size, and boosting fruit or flower production. Routine pruning removes dead, harmed, or overcrowded stems, which improves airflow, light penetration, and reduces the risk of illness. Proper timing and technique depend upon the kind of vine, its growth routine, and the wanted outcome, whether for decorative functions or fruit production. Strategies such as heading cuts, thinning cuts, and training along trellises or supports guide the plant's development and improve structural strength. Pruning also encourages energetic new shoots and flowering, while keeping vines from becoming invasive or thick. A constant pruning schedule promotes long-lasting health and visual appeal, guaranteeing vines stay attractive and efficient. Correct vine management adds to total landscape visual appeals and boosts the functionality of garden features such as arbors, pergolas, and fences
